Impartiality and Accountability as Ingredients of Truste of Western democracy, but is taken for granted and neglected rather than nurtured. Despite its centrality to democratic governance, the practice of impartiality within government communications faces four main challenges. Conclusion: Putting the Public Firstions vulnerable and easily suppressed. After 1997 a new semi-official layer of media intermediaries was introduced without on-going scrutiny, training or effective sanction, and without recognising the news management role of ministers through their special advisers.
